首页 > 精选问答 >

abstraction

2025-09-11 20:35:19

问题描述:

abstraction,在线等,求秒回,真的火烧眉毛!

最佳答案

推荐答案

2025-09-11 20:35:19

abstraction】抽象(Abstraction)是将复杂系统或概念简化为更易理解的形式的过程。它在计算机科学、数学、艺术等多个领域中被广泛应用。通过抽象,人们可以忽略细节,专注于核心特征,从而提高效率和可管理性。本文将从定义、作用、应用场景及优缺点等方面对“abstraction”进行总结,并以表格形式呈现关键信息。

项目 内容
定义 抽象是指从具体事物中提取共性,去除不相关细节,形成更高层次的概念或模型。
作用 简化复杂问题、提升效率、促进模块化设计、增强可维护性与扩展性。
常见领域 计算机科学(如编程语言、数据结构)、数学(如集合论、函数)、艺术(如抽象绘画)。
优点 - 降低认知负担
- 提高代码/系统的可重用性
- 便于团队协作与沟通
缺点 - 可能丢失重要细节
- 过度抽象可能导致性能下降
- 需要较高的理解能力
应用场景 - 软件开发中的类与接口设计
- 数据库的逻辑模型设计
- 艺术创作中的风格表达

总结:

抽象是一种重要的思维方式和工具,帮助我们在面对复杂世界时,找到简洁而有效的解决方案。无论是技术开发还是艺术表现,抽象都能提供一种清晰的视角,使我们能够聚焦于真正重要的部分。然而,抽象并非万能,它需要在简化与保留必要信息之间找到平衡。合理运用抽象,能够显著提升工作效率与创造力。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。